Before I close, I would like to share a little story from my past with you. 

“You don't love someone because they're perfect, you love them in spite of the fact that they're not.” ― Jodi Picoult

Many years ago, when my hubby and I were newly weds, we had a silly spat. I don't even recall what it was about. Anyway, he left the apartment and when he returned, he gave me this little skunk. As you can see, the inscription says, "Love me in spite of my faults." I've kept it all these years and I smile whenever I look at it. The skunk is pretty cute, just like my wonderful hubby. I am blessed to have someone so dear in my life!
All through our marriage we never allowed a disagreement to fester for very long. It is very important to work things out. Who knows, perhaps a little skunk will bring a smile to your face!
